Photo: Whippet cheerleader signs with Holmes
A Kosciusko Whippets cheerleader is heading to cheer at Holmes Community College.
Savannah Fulgham signed with the Bulldogs Friday morning during a ceremony at Kosciusko High School.

Natchez Trace Festival vendor applications available
Vendor applications are now being accepted for the 53rd annual Natchez Trace Festival.
Arts and crafts vendor applications can be found online here.
This year's event is set for Friday, April 28- Saturday, April 29.
